Power board BN44-00197a has 126v on hot section nothing on cold side. Have checked transformer and coils for continuity and OK . did replace 6 caps on top rhs of the low voltag e area although originals all look OK . the set apparently working normally was turned off but wouldn't start next day no light no clicking nothing. Board has no sign of any problem. Located in country Australia and components not readily available and prices for another board not justified these days. Have schematic and understand basics. Any experience of this problem appreciate your comments.

Re: Samsung LA40A650A1F no 5.3v standby
You check the Diodes DM801, DM803 whci are for the switched 13V, DM805 for the STB5.3V use Diode mode on the meter and also test with Ohms mode, no need to remove them unless the readings look bad.
You also need to check ZDM802, ZDM803 Diodes, the caps CM802, 814, 815 capacitance and ESR.Attached FilesNever stop learning

Re: Samsung LA40A650A1F no 5.3v standby
The hot side is floating at 150 odd volts with ref to chassis. For hot side checks use filter-cap neg term as neg for meter.
Cold side will give usual readings ref to chassis....TELEFIX

Re: Samsung LA40A650A1F no 5.3v standby
you cannot use the chassis GND as the GND ref when making the DCV reding in the HOT side of the circuit, you need to use the Negative leg of the main filter cap as the GND ref for your meter.
So what DCV do you have between the two legs of the main filter cap in the HOT side of the circuit? around 325VDC? We need this Voltage first.
You need to concentrate in the STBY power supply section first.Last edited by budm; 01-29-2016, 05:58 PM.Never stop learning

Re: Samsung LA40A650A1F no 5.3v standby
You said fuse FI801 is good, then you should have 343VDC with ref to the Negative legs of the main filter caps of either CP802 or 803, that fuse (page 3) feeds the Voltage to STBY transformer TM801 pin 6, so you should verify if you have the DCV on pin 6.
ICM802 STBY SMPS IC ICE2QS01 HV pin 4 and 5 are the startup Voltage receiving pins, what do you have on that PIN?
What do you have on VCC pin 7 which the cap CM814 is charged by by the HV pin until it reaches the VCC ON THRESOLD of 22VDC for the circuit t start up, onec that happen the AUX winding (PIN 1 ,2) of the TM801 will provide the running Voltage.
See diagram page 2 and 3 to see how it works.Attached FilesLast edited by budm; 01-29-2016, 09:06 PM.Never stop learning

Re: Samsung LA40A650A1F no 5.3v standby
So the resistance of those three 3.9K resistors connected in series to provide the 22VDC start up Voltage to pin 4/5 are OK? Check the resistance between HV pin 4 and the GND pin 8 to see what resistance you are getting, it just a simple Voltage divider to drop the 325VDC (230vac x 1.414 = 325VDC on the main filter cap), you AC line Voltage must be higher than 230VDC for you to have 343VDC on the main filter cap, your meter is OK and in calibration?Last edited by budm; 01-30-2016, 12:03 AM.Never stop learning
